It depends on how items are being sent. A lot of items can be sent as large letters, which can be $2.20 to post, depending on weight.

 

Or it could be a loss-leader. Or it could be sourced from a country that charges almost nothing to post exports. In which case AP and the Australian taxpayer cover the difference.
